" Situated in this great Uphill location is this superbly presented and spacious Mid-Terraced Property a short walk away from the historic Bailgate Quarter giving access to a great variety of shops, bars, restaurants and schooling. Accommodation comprising; Lounge, Dining Room, Modern Kitchen, good sized Family Bathroom, Three Bedrooms (Two being double) and Large Enclosed Rear Garden. The property boasts many original features including sash windows and further benefits from Gas Central Heating throughout.

Viewings are highly advisable to appreciate the spacious and well presented accommodation on offer.

Location:
Situated within the highly sought after Uphill location close to the Cathedral Quarter and Bishop Grosseteste University and within easy walking distance to a wide range of local amenities including shops, bars, cafes, restaurants, doctors surgery and local primary and secondary schooling. Lincoln has the benefit of the A46 dual carriageway linking to the main A1 and is approximately a 20 minute drive from Newark Northgate Station which benefits from a service direct to London Kings Cross.
